Step-by-Step Instructions

Step 1
Begin by placing the boneless, skinless chicken into the slow cooker. Pour in the chicken broth and condensed cream of chicken soup, then add chopped onions, seasonings, and a pat of butter.
Step 2
Cover and cook on low for 6 to 8 hours or on high for 3 to 4 hours until the chicken is tender and fully cooked.
Step 3
Once the chicken is cooked, remove it and shred it into bite-sized pieces. Stir the shredded chicken back into the broth and raise the heat to high.
Step 4
Place the refrigerated biscuits on top of the broth, cover, and let them cook for about 30 minutes until they are fluffy and cooked through.
Step 5
Serve hot in bowls, garnished with fresh herbs if desired, and enjoy a comforting meal with family.

Ingredient Substitutions

  • You can substitute chicken thighs for chicken breasts but adjust cooking time if thicker pieces are used.
  • If you don’t have condensed soup, mixing heavy cream with a bit of chicken stock can work as an alternative to maintain creaminess.

Storage Tips

Store any leftovers in a sealed container in the refrigerator for up to three days. For longer storage, this dish can be frozen; however, it’s best to separate the dumplings from the broth to retain their texture. When reheating, add a splash of chicken broth to refresh the dish and prevent it from drying out.
